+<h1><span style="font-size: 12.5pt; color: black">Auto-Configuration</span>
+<span style="font-size: 12.5pt; color: black">Basics</span></h1>
+<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">Prior
+to Microsoft� Windows� Vista, the settings of a print queue are set initially to
+the driver's default settings, rather than to the appropriate settings based on
+the device. For Unidrv or Pscript5, this means that static default values
+specified in the GPD or PPD file are used for the initial print queue setup.
+This static set of defaults necessarily must represent the minimum configuration
+that a printer can ship with. For instance, if a stapling unit is optional for a
+device, then by default, such a device cannot have stapling capability enabled,
+otherwise the user interface for devices without the stapling unit would show
+stapling as an option. A customer who selected the stapling option but found
+that it did not work would likely be confused.</span></p>
+<p><span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">For any device that
+comes with features not present in the basic model, a user or administrator must
+manually configure these features on the print queue after installation. This
+can at times be a confusing and non-intuitive experience. The configuration
+process is easy to get wrong, particularly with regard to internal parameters
+such as memory and hard disk size, which significantly can affect printing speed
+and quality. </span></p>
+<p><span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">Auto-configuration</span>
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">solves this problem by
+automatically configuring the print queue according to the installable features
+on the device, rather than simply using the driver's static default settings.
+The main target for auto-configuration is network printers. They are the most
+likely ones to have multiple optional features and require more manual
+configuration.</span></p>
+<p><span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">Auto-configuration</span>
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">works by means of
+bi-directional printer communication (also known as bidi communication) between
+the print subsystem and the printer. In order for auto-configuration to work,
+the printer must be able to:</span></p>
+<p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: -.25in; margin-left: 22.8pt; margin-bottom: .1in">
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Symbol; color: black">�<span style="font-style: normal; font-variant: normal; font-weight: normal; font-size: 7.0pt; font-family: Times New Roman">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;
+</span></span>
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ana; color: black">Understand a
+query sent by the port monitor. </span></p>
+<p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: -.25in; margin-left: 22.8pt; margin-bottom: .1in">
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Symbol; color: black">�<span style="font-style: normal; font-variant: normal; font-weight: normal; font-size: 7.0pt; font-family: Times New Roman">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;
+</span></span>
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ana; color: black">Generate the
+appropriate response to the query. </span></p>
+<p><span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">To support
+auto-configuration, both the printer driver and the port monitor must be
+modified.</span></p>
+<p><span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">A <i>printer driver</i>
+must:</span></p>
+<p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: -.25in; margin-left: 22.8pt; margin-bottom: .1in">
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Symbol; color: black">�<span style="font-style: normal; font-variant: normal; font-weight: normal; font-size: 7.0pt; font-family: Times New Roman">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;
+</span></span>
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ana; color: black">Be aware of
+the Bidi Notification Schema. </span></p>
+<p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: -.25in; margin-left: 22.8pt; margin-bottom: .1in">
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Symbol; color: black">�<span style="font-style: normal; font-variant: normal; font-weight: normal; font-size: 7.0pt; font-family: Times New Roman">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;
+</span></span>
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ana; color: black">Be able to
+receive notifications about device configuration changes using the Bidi
+Notification Schema. </span></p>
+<p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: -.25in; margin-left: 22.8pt; margin-bottom: .1in">
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Symbol; color: black">�<span style="font-style: normal; font-variant: normal; font-weight: normal; font-size: 7.0pt; font-family: Times New Roman">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;
+</span></span>
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ana; color: black">Be able to
+solicit configuration data from the printer using the Bidi Communication
+Interfaces, and specifically the <b>IBidiSpl2</b> COM interface (described in
+the Platform SDK documentation). </span></p>
+<p><span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">A <i>port monitor</i>
+must:</span></p>
+<p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: -.25in; margin-left: 22.8pt; margin-bottom: .1in">
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Symbol; color: black">�<span style="font-style: normal; font-variant: normal; font-weight: normal; font-size: 7.0pt; font-family: Times New Roman">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;
+</span></span>
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ana; color: black">Support a
+device protocol capable of querying the printer's configuration. </span></p>
+<p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: -.25in; margin-left: 22.8pt; margin-bottom: .1in">
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Symbol; color: black">�<span style="font-style: normal; font-variant: normal; font-weight: normal; font-size: 7.0pt; font-family: Times New Roman">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;
+</span></span>
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ana; color: black">Be able to
+receive unsolicited status messages from the printer. </span></p>
+<p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: -.25in; margin-left: 22.8pt; margin-bottom: .1in">
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Symbol; color: black">�<span style="font-style: normal; font-variant: normal; font-weight: normal; font-size: 7.0pt; font-family: Times New Roman">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;
+</span></span>
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ana; color: black">Convert
+unsolicited status messages to an appropriate driver notification. </span></p>
+<p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: -.25in; margin-left: 22.8pt; margin-bottom: .1in">
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Symbol; color: black">�<span style="font-style: normal; font-variant: normal; font-weight: normal; font-size: 7.0pt; font-family: Times New Roman">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;
+</span></span>
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ana; color: black">Keep all of
+the device status and configuration data up-to date by means of polling or
+alerts. </span></p>
+<p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: -.25in; margin-left: 22.8pt; margin-bottom: .1in">
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Symbol; color: black">�<span style="font-style: normal; font-variant: normal; font-weight: normal; font-size: 7.0pt; font-family: Times New Roman">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;
+</span></span>
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ana; color: black">Inform the
+driver or application of any configuration changes in the device. </span></p>
+<p><span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">Unidrv-based and
+PScript5-based drivers using the standard TCP/IP port monitor or the
+Network-Connected Device (NCD) port monitor provide support for
+auto-configuration.</span></p>
+<h3><a name="MYSAMPLE"><span lang="FR" style="font-family: Verdana">CODE TOUR</span></a></h3>
+<p class="MsoNormal"><span lang="FR">&nbsp;</span></p>
+<p class="MsoNormal"><b>
+<span lang="FR" style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">Unidrv</span></b><span lang="FR">
+</span><b><span lang="FR" style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">
+Auto-Configuration Sample</span></b></p>
+<p class="MsoNormal"><b>
+<span lang="FR" style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">&nbsp;</span></b></p>
+<p class="MsoPlainText"><span style="font-family: Verdana">The main part of the
+sample is the auto-configuration GDL file ACnfgUni.GDL. This file implements
+the&nbsp; *BidiQuery, *BidiResponse and *Option elements that correspond to the
+Memory, DuplexUnit and PrinterHardDisk features in AutoCnfg.GPD file. The
+Feature and Option names in the auto-configuration GDL file should exaclty match
+the corresponding Feature and Option names in the GPD file. The
+auto-configuration GDL file is specified in the GPD file using the *<b>BidiQueryFile</b>
+keyword. The auto-configuration GDL content can also be contained directly
+inside the GPD file itself instead of in a separate GDL file, in which case the
+*BidiQueryFile keyword should specify the GPD file name.</span></p>
+<p class="MsoPlainText">&nbsp; </p>
+<p class="MsoNormal"><b><span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">
+PScript5 Auto-Configuration</span></b> <b>
+<span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">Sample</span></b></p>
+<p class="MsoNormal"><b><span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">&nbsp;</span></b></p>
+<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">The
+main part of the sample is the auto-configuration GDL file ACnfgPS.GDL. This
+file implements the *BidiQuery, *BidiResponse and *Option elements that
+corresponds to the InstalledMemory, DuplexUnit and HardDisk features in
+AutoCnfg.PPD file. As mentioned for the Unidrv sample, the Feature and Option
+names should exactly match. Please note that the GPD and PPD files do not have
+the same Feature and Option names. That is why the two GDL files are not
+identical. The auto-configuration GDL file is specified in the PPD file using
+the *<b>MSBidiQueryFile </b>keyword.</span></p>
+<h3><span style="font-family: Verdana">INSTALLING/TESTING THE SAMPLE</span> </h3>
+<p><span style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: Verdana">The samples don�t have
+any binaries to be built. They may be installed by using Add Printer Wizard and
+supplying the AutoCnfg.INF as the INF file. To test the auto-configuration
+feature you need to install the driver to a Standard TCP/IP port.&nbsp; You need a
+printer, which understands and responds to the bidi SNMP queries, connected to
+the port. The tcpbidi.xml file located in system32 directory has information
+about the SNMP OIDs used for each query. The installable options in the device
+settings will reflect the information obtained by querying the printer.</span>
+</p>
